Frequently Asked Questions about Palm City
How much are Studio apartments in Palm City?
There are currently 24 Studio Apartments in Palm City with rent ranges from $1,659 to $1,977 with an average price of $1,867.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Palm City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Palm City ranges from $1,500 to $3,107 with an average monthly rent of $1,953.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Palm City c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Palm City range from $1,611 to $3,582.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,287.
How expensive are Palm City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 25 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Palm City on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,014 to $4,813 - averaging $2,679 for the location.
